The company has garnered a mixed reputation, with some customers praising the efficiency and support of specific staff members during the leasing process, highlighting a seamless experience and quick move-in times. However, significant concerns have emerged regarding service delays, inadequate maintenance, and poor communication. Many customers reported unresolved issues, including mold and plumbing problems, alongside frustrations over application fees and lack of responsiveness from management. Overall, while there are positive experiences, the recurring complaints suggest a need for improved customer service and property management practices to enhance tenant satisfaction and retention.

This might be a little long but I'll share all the information that I have currently. About a month ago myself and two friends went through Main Street Renewal in order to rent a house for one year. The property is in Lehigh acres Florida. This morning, three days before myself and my friends are supposed to move in, we received an email stating that there is an individual occupying the house. I immediately called them up and they told me I have two options, I can either receive a full refund, or they can transfer my lease to another property. The lease is already signed by all parties, so I called a friend who told me I should call up the sheriffs office. I was informed by the desk officer that if the individual is not a previous renter, The owner of the house would be able to call the sheriffs department and have them evicted as a trespasser, however, if the person has ever had a lease before, there is due process that the property management company and property owner must go through. I was informed by the county clerk that I would need to contact an attorney to see if the rental property would need to cover me for all moving, temporary lodging, and storage costs as we were informed three days before the start of the lease. My parents think that this is possible price gouging in the terms that the rental company accepted two different applications and is trying to get us to agree to a lease on a more expensive property. I have the entire lease signed and printed out saved to my desktop. I'm thinking of moving forward in a law suit as this company failed to provide lodging based upon the agreed upon contract. I informed them I would take another property at the previously agreed price but they refused to do so. I've been in contact with my attorney and will be moving forward with a law suit.

We provide our residents with a great house, an easy lease experience, and attentive service so they can create a home they love.
Each home has been renovated to increase its functionality and aesthetic. This process includes neutral colors, stylish fixtures, and an appliance package.
We strive to provide you with a beautifully crafted design so you’ll feel right at home.
With more than 34,000 properties in dozens of markets, Main Street Renewal is one of the country’s largest providers of single-family homes.
